Community Bridges, Inc. (CBI) is an integrated behavioral healthcare agency offering a variety of different programs throughout Arizona. CBI provides residential, outpatient, inpatient, patient-centered medical homes, medication-assisted treatment, and crisis services to individuals experiencing crisis, opioid use disorder, homelessness, and mental illness.

We currently seek Clinical Coordinator for our SMI program , Heritage, in Mesa.

A Community Bridges Inc. (CBI) Clinical Coordinator provides clinical and administrative supervision, clinical oversight, training, and mentoring for Case Managers and Rehabilitation Specialist on an assigned team. Ensures clinical quality and productivity standards are met and exceeded by direct reports. Ensures assessments and treatment plans are developed and implemented for each patient on their team.

ESSENTIAL JOB DUTIES OR RESPONSIBILITIES

  • Coordinates day to day operations of their assigned team.
  • Serves as a point of contact for the team during business hours for community stakeholders.
  • Ensure weekly team meeting is being facilitated in an effective manner.
  • Assesses competency of clinical staff through observation and testing techniques. 
  • Assists clinical staff in developing required competencies, documents training and coaching moments in employee file.
  • Monitors daily activities and coordinates care with supportive members and providers.
  • Assesses patient needs, including assessing for high-risk indicators and documents history/assessment in a manner that is clinically pertinent to the individual patient.
  • Ensures required face to face interaction with each assigned patient is provided and documented accordingly.
  • Participates in treatment planning sessions and assists treatment team by coordinating planning effort.
  • Addresses barriers and concerns with patients, stakeholders and team members.
  • Acts as liaison for program members and their families to various community agencies, hospital consultants and services.
  • Works closely with Clinical Leadership to ensure monthly deliverables and outcomes are being met.
  • Provides back up to the on-call and team members, when needed.
  • Provides services in the field, at the member’s home or where the member is currently located.
  • Provides training of staff on various issues and topics relevant to the specific member population.
  • Documents interaction with each member on a daily basis prior to the end of his or her scheduled shift.
  • Participates in daily staffing and provides insight and updates on the member’s progress as well as recommendations for additional services that will help the member be successful.
  • Provides outreach and engagement activities daily in addition to after hour response while on-call or when member requests assistance.
  • Works with staff to ensure timely discharge from hospital setting by ensuring discharge planning begins at intake.
  • Continues ongoing education and training with internal and external training partners.
  • Participates in petitioning process as determined necessary 24/7.
  • Other duties as assigned.

Minimum Education & Experience Required:

  • Bachelor’s degree in a field related to behavioral health OR a combination of education, training, and/or experience
  • 1 year experience working with the SMI population with additional experience in multiple settings and levels of care, including both mental health and substance abuse
  • 1 year experience in a behavioral health position providing outreach and engagement activities.
  • Ability to pass criminal background check for jail visitation/clearance
  • Valid Arizona Driver’s License with 39 month clear MVR
  • Behavioral Health Technician (BHT) 
  • CPR/First Aid
  • Crisis Prevention Institute (CPI)
